Abstract

Hydrogen-based ironmaking is one of the promising strategies for achieving a carbon-neutral ironmaking process. However, Hydrogen-Direct Reduced Iron (H2-DRI) contains almost no carbon, resulting in higher energy consumption during the smelting process. The present study investigates the feasibility of using industrial off-gas as carburizing agents for H2-DRI through CALPHAD thermodynamic calculations and laboratory-scale experiments. The carburizing potential, evaluated in terms of the extent of Fe3C formation, revealed that CO and CH4 were effective in carburization at low and high temperatures, respectively. Among the off-gases, COG–LDG mixtures exhibited higher carburizing potentials for H2-DRI than COG–BFG due to their lower CO2 content. High-temperature carburization was found to be less favorable as it hindered Fe3C formation while promoting free carbon deposition. The study defined a Carburization Ratio and Carbon Utilization Ratio to assess carburization effectiveness. Additionally, the melting behavior observed indicated that sole carburization was insufficient for complete melting; thus, simultaneous consideration of fluxing and carburization is necessary. These findings advance fundamental understanding of gaseous carburization and its implications for optimizing H2-DRI melting in the smelting process.
